About the role:
The Director, Asia Pacific, will lead regional crew mobility and travel operations, working closely with manning agencies, business partners, and internal stakeholders to ensure seamless end-to-end travel experiences for crew members across the region.
This newly created role will serve as the face of the Asia Pacific operations, combining operational excellence, business development, and stakeholder management to strengthen crew mobility, drive cost efficiency, and enhance the overall crew experience.
Role and Responsibilities:
Leadership & Strategy:
Establish and lead Asia Pacific crew & travel operations, aligning with global standards.
Build strategic partnerships with manning agencies, government stakeholders, and vendors to support crew sourcing, mobility, and deployment.
Act as the face of the company in the region, driving brand presence and fostering strong relationships with key partners.
Operations & Risk Management:
Oversee end-to-end crew mobility, including scheduling, flights, lodging, immigration, and port logistics.
Implement risk management strategies to ensure business continuity during crises, emergencies, or travel disruptions.
Ensure full compliance with regional labour laws, maritime regulations, visa requirements, and health/safety standards.
Business Development & Growth:
Develop new business opportunities and partnerships that support crew travel efficiency and long-term scalability.
Collaborate with internal stakeholders to design innovative travel solutions that reduce costs and improve crew satisfaction.
Lead financial modelling and budget forecasting for regional travel operations, ensuring fiscal discipline and ROI.
Stakeholder Engagement:
Serve as a senior representative in the Asia Pacific, engaging with manning agencies, vendors, and government partners.
Collaborate cross-functionally with HR, Operations, and Finance to integrate crew mobility into broader business goals.
Track launch KPIs, support markets, and guide to oversee plan execution. Champion the crew experience by designing programs that support welfare, safety, and retention
Requirements:
12+ years of leadership experience in crew mobility, maritime operations, or global travel management.
Strong background in the cruise, shipping, or aviation industries; vessel/sea-based leadership experience (e.g., ex-Captain or maritime officer) is highly desirable.
Proven ability to build and lead business operations from the ground up, with an entrepreneurial mindset.
Track record in business development, vendor negotiations, and stakeholder engagement across the Asia Pacific region.
Deep expertise in risk management, operational strategy, and financial modelling.
Strong partnership management skills, particularly with manning agencies and travel service providers.
Culturally agile, with global/regional experience and willingness to travel extensively.
Excellent communication, presentation, and relationship-building skills at the executive level.
